在Laravel中如何设置和管理动态数据库连接

发布时间:2024-05-30 15:38:03 作者:小樊
来源:亿速云 阅读:145

在Laravel中,要设置和管理动态数据库连接,可以使用Config Facade和DB Facade来实现。以下是设置和管理动态数据库连接的步骤:

  1. 设置动态数据库连接配置:
Config::set('database.connections.dynamic_connection', [
    'driver' => 'mysql',
    'host' => 'localhost',
    'database' => 'dynamic_database',
    'username' => 'root',
    'password' => '',
    'charset' => 'utf8',
    'collation' => 'utf8_unicode_ci',
    'prefix' => '',
]);
  1. 获取动态数据库连接:
$dynamicConnection = DB::connection('dynamic_connection');
  1. 使用动态数据库连接进行查询:
$results = $dynamicConnection->select('select * from table');
  1. 关闭动态数据库连接:
$dynamicConnection->disconnect();

通过以上步骤,您可以在Laravel中设置和管理动态数据库连接。您可以根据需要在不同的地方动态切换数据库连接,并执行相应的数据库操作。

推荐阅读:
  1. laravel框架报403错误怎么解决
  2. laravel中wherehas有什么作用

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

laravel

上一篇:Laravel环境中的服务容器是如何解析对象依赖的

下一篇:Laravel如何处理和优化长时间运行的脚本或命令

相关阅读

您好,登录后才能下订单哦!

密码登录
登录注册
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》